Messi scores 800th goal of his career with a free-kick against Panama

Lionel Messi set a new record by scoring his 800th career goal on a free kick against Panama.
Argentina faced Panama in the early hours of Friday morning for the first time since winning the World Cup in Qatar 2022.
Coach Lionel Scaloni named the same starting lineup that faced France in the FIFA World Cup final, and captain Lionel Messi was on track to set a new career high.
After a dull first half, Argentina broke the deadlock in the 78th minute when Leandro Paredes found Thiago Almeida, who neatly tucked in the ball.
The ‘Lionel Messi moment’ came late in the game, when he curled in a free-kick to the top right corner.
The PSG star’s strike against Panama marked his 800th career goal, following his 799th against Nantes in Ligue 1.
